if(sampleAverage ==1) setFIFOAverage(MAX30105_SAMPLEAVG_1);//No averaging per FIFO recordelseif(sampleAverage ==2) setFIFOAverage(MAX30105_SAMPLEAVG_2);elseif(sampleAverage ==4) setFIFOAverage(MAX30105_SAMPLEAVG_4);elseif(sampleAverage ==8) setFIFOAverage(MAX30105_SAMPLEAVG_8);elseif...
uint8_tMAX30105::readPartID(){returnreadRegister8(_i2caddr, MAX30105_PARTID); } MAX30105_PARTID:值为0xFF。作用是读取部件id。部件id固定是0x15,所以可以推出来MAX_30105_EXPECTEDPARTID的值是0x15。 voidMAX30105::readRevisionID(){ revisionID = readRegister8(_i2caddr, MAX30105_REVISIONID);...
为了帮助你使用ESP32 DevKit V1开发板驱动MAX30102传感器,我将按照你提供的提示分点回答,并包括必要的代码片段。 1. 准备ESP32 DevKit V1开发环境 首先,你需要安装Arduino IDE,并配置ESP32开发板支持。以下是步骤: 安装Arduino IDE:从Arduino官网下载并安装Arduino IDE。 添加ESP32开发板支持:打开...
MAX30102采用1.8V单电源供电,内部LED由3.3V独立供电。通信功能通过标准I2C兼容接口实现。该模块可以在无待机电流的情况下,通过软件关闭,使电源轨道持续供电。 怎样把wifi模块ESP32连接到MAX30102。 MAX30102传感器具有I2C接口。所以,我们只需要用到ESP32 48针中的四针,并将其连接到MAX30102,就可以完成心率和脉搏血氧饱...
ESP32S3是一款强大的微控制器,常用于物联网(IoT)应用,具有集成Wi-Fi和蓝牙功能。在本文中,我们将深入探讨如何利用ESP32S3来驱动MAX30102传感器,该传感器专门设计用于测量心率和血氧饱和度(SpO2)。这两项指标在健康监测设备中至关重要。\n\n了解MAX30102传感器。MAX30102
MAX30102 Configuration: MAXwrite_to_register(Mode_Configuration, 0x02); // 0x02 HR Mode, 0x03 SpO2 Mode, 0x07 Multi-LED. // LED Power config MAXwrite_to_register(LED_Pulse_Amplitude_RED, 0xFF); MAXwrite_to_register(LED_Pulse_Amplitude_IR, 0xFF); // 0x24 ...
MAX30102 心率血氧传感器 0.96寸 4P OLED显示屏 因为MAX30102和 OLED显示屏都是通过I2C跟ESP开发板链接,所以需要自定义一对接口(SLC、SDA)。LED用默认的 PIN21,PIN22,MAX30102用PIN5,PIN23 所以初始化的时候 LED用 SSD1306Wire display(0x3c,SDA, SCL);//21,22 即默认Wire ...
## 材料 + ESP WROOM 32位开发板 + MAX30102 心率血氧传感器 + 0.96寸 4P OLED显示屏 因为MAX30102和 OLED显示屏都是通过I2C跟ESP开发板链接,所以需要自定义一对接口(SLC、SDA)。LED用默认的 PIN21,PIN22,MAX3…
ESP32 MAX30102 Web血氧仪 嘉立创产业服务站群 电子产业 嘉立创PCB PCB、FPC制造服务 嘉立创FPC 柔性板5片起订,24小时交货 嘉立创SMT 一站式PCBA服务平台 嘉立创激光/纳米钢网 高性价比钢网、纳米/阶梯钢网 嘉立创发热片 20元特价打样,免费下载源文件...
MAX30102 是一个集成了心率和脉搏血氧监测功能的模组,包含内部 LED、光电探测器、光学元件,以及具有环境光抑制功能的低噪声电子设备。MAX30102 提供了一个完整的系统解决方案,简化了移动和可穿戴设备的设计过程。 MAX30102 采用 1.8 V 单电源供电,其内部 LED 采用单独的 3.3 V 电源供电。通过标准的 I2C 兼容接口实...